It’s simple. A domain registration has the sole function of specifying DNS servers. In order to find services provided for your domain name, a number called an IP address is required. DNS servers map names to these numbers. The DNS servers have entries like: BaileysKarate.com -> 216.185.152.158 www.BaileysKarate.com -> 216.185.152.158 They give out this information […]
